Healthcare and Medical Services

The healthcare industry plays a vital role in Jefferson Parish's economy, with a multitude of healthcare facilities and medical institutions providing excellent career prospects. Ochsner Health, one of the leading healthcare systems in the region, offers a wide range of job opportunities, including nursing, medical support staff, administrative roles, and specialized medical positions. With its state-of-the-art facilities and commitment to patient care, Ochsner Health attracts top talent and provides a rewarding work environment.

In addition to Ochsner Health, Jefferson Parish is home to various other healthcare providers, such as East Jefferson General Hospital, West Jefferson Medical Center, and numerous specialized clinics. These institutions offer a range of employment opportunities, from clinical roles to administrative and support positions, ensuring a steady demand for healthcare professionals.

Oil and Gas Industry

Jefferson Parish has a strong presence in the oil and gas industry, which has been a cornerstone of the regional economy for decades. The parish's strategic location along the Mississippi River and its proximity to the Gulf of Mexico make it an ideal hub for oil and gas exploration, production, and distribution. Major oil and gas companies, such as Chevron, Shell, and BP, have established operations in Jefferson Parish, offering a wide range of employment opportunities.
